(Nox) “Good morning, will you let go of me now?”
?!?!?!
I woke up lying next to Nox, Why?!
Last night! What happened last night?!
I cried then… nothing? AH, I fell asleep! Hugging Nox…
(Nox) “Stella, if you don’t want me to leave the bed- Wha?! Ouch.”
I immediately panicked and pushed him as hard as I could. He fell off the bed and landed on his back. Seeing that, I started to feel bad.
(Stella) (Did that hurt?)
(Nox) “Hey, you finally spoke! Maybe I should tease you more often.”
But I didn’t speak… telepathy? I finally used it! Wait, he’s going to do what?!
I glared at him and tried to ‘speak’ again.
You just think it's fun to make fun of me!
And I failed miserably.
(Nox) “So, I should? Well, if you insist. It sounds like a lot of fun, at least for me, anyway.”
He said with that annoying grin on his face.
So it is for fun!
I just continue to glare at him while yelling at him in my mind.
(Nox) “Well, enough of that for now. I will go out for a bit, so you, stay here and rest. I’ll be right back with something I need you to see.”
Then he got up and left without even waiting for my reply.
I wonder what he’ll bring back?
I lay back down on the bed for a few minutes before...
I’m bored. He told me to rest, but after that wake-up, I am wide awake.
So, I got up to explore this ‘gods’ house.
I just realized that I've never looked around this place before. I wonder what a god has lying around his house?
First, I looked through the kitchen. It’s just a normal modern kitchen… though I can’t open the fridge for some reason. I can't see any lock on it, so maybe it's magic?
Next, I looked through that ark by the side of the room that's been bugging me. I can see a gigantic flat screen TV in front of me as soon as I walk into the room. Who knew gods watch TV? The couch facing the TV looks sooo comfortable. The left wall is practically a bookshelf that is so filled I can't find any gaps. The right side has 2 smaller bookshelves on either side of a window, both of them are just as full.

I went over to the window and looked outside.
So pretty...
Outside the window is a small flower garden. All of the flowers are either white or black, but they go well together. Seeing it from here makes me think those flowers may have a pattern. If only I could see them from above.
The sound of the door being closed woke me up from my daze, Nox had come back.
(Nox) “I’m back! Stella, come here for a bit.”
I walked out of the TV room and over to the door where Nox was standing.
(Nox) “Outside there is someone who wants to meet you. Don’t worry, I will be right behind you the whole time.”
What do I need to be worried about?
I got my answer as soon as I opened the door.
And I froze.
...
(Silva) “I am so sorry for yesterday.”
What is he doing here?! No, wait, he said sorry?
(Silva) “Nox came over to explain the situation to me… I never even considered that you couldn’t talk… I got overly excited when I met my first human and wanted to talk to you, so when I thought you ignored me I got mad and took it out on you… Sorry.”
(Nox) “Now, why don’t you come in and talk? We can't stand here all day.”
I didn’t know what to do, so I just followed Nox as he walked inside and sat down at the table.
(Nox) “Stella, can you let go of my shirt now?”
When did I?!
I let go quickly and looked down, embarrassed, and probably with a red face…
I hope he won't tease me about this… why did I grab his shirt? Was I that scared?
(Nox) “Silva, you too, sit.”
(Silva) “Yes…”
Now that we are all sitting at the table…
*Silence*
(Nox) “*Sigh*, Silva, even if Stella can’t talk, you can.”
(Silva) “Yes…”
*Silence*
(Nox) “Ok, this is getting nowhere... Silva, why don't you come back tomorrow after you've calmed down and thought about what you want to talk about?”
(Silva) “Ok…”
He then quickly gets up and walks out the door.
What was that?
Nothing else happened for the next week. I didn't want to go on walks, so I stayed inside while Nox tried to teach me telepathy with a bit of success. It's nothing major, but I can now answer with a few words like a 2-year-old… At least it's an improvement.

Silva also kept showing up, but we just stayed silent for about a half an hour before he left. No improvement there.
I also started eating food again. I can only eat soup now, but Nox said I can soon eat solids. He also said I will be getting a new body after my soul is stable, and that I will go to a fantasy-like world. I’m not getting reborn, just sent there.
Luckily, I will be able to talk to any god I want once I’m there. Even if I die, I will just be sent back here… but most ways of dying are painful, so let's hope that I can die of old age.
It's not like I didn't ask why I couldn’t reincarnate like my parents, but Nox wouldn’t tell me. He would try and change the subject whenever I brought something like that up.
Nox said his mom will explain more when I get my body. I’m not sure I want to meet her though, she is part of the reason that I… anyway, that is for the future.
Today something different happened.
*Knock, knock*
(Nox) “Silva, come in.”
(Silva) “...”
(Nox) “*Sigh* Today, I’m leaving you two alone, so at least try and talk to her Silva. Bye.”
(Silva) “Wait!”
But he was already gone…
What just happened? Did I get abandoned?!
(Silva) “...”
…
(Silva) “...”
…
(Silva) “...”
…
(Silva) “Want to play a game?”
I slowly nodded… this is awkward.
We walked to the room with the giant flatscreen TV.
(Silva) “Do you like video games?”
I nodded and he went towards the left bookshelf.
So that’s what that was, Nox doesn’t come in here often so I thought he didn’t like TV but if that shelf is full of games then… I wonder why we didn’t play any?
(Silva) “Then... how about this one? Our mother made it a long time ago in case we wanted to manage the believers under our domains. She wanted us to know how much work it takes. That makes a great game if we can turn it off whenever we want, but reality is much more difficult. Still, this game is one of the best mother has ever made.”
He must really like games, that’s the most I’ve ever heard him talk... eternal deities playing video games…
(Silva) “What do you say? Do you want to play?”
I nodded and he touched the game to the flatscreen. The game got absorbed and the TV turned on…
Then he handed me a PS4 controller… not what I was expecting.
(Silva) “Here’s your controller. I’ll help you with the voice commands.”
WHAT?! What kind of game is this?!
And so, we started the game.
[1 hour later.]
(Nox) “I’m home!”
(Silva) “We’re in the game room!”
So it was a game room…
(Stella) (Nox… Why…)
That was the best I could do, but Nox can understand me for the most part because all we did in the last week was talk. Who knew there was a better alternative like gaming? Yes, I’m mad at Nox for not telling me.
(Silva) “You spoke?! I thought you couldn't speak?”
(Nox) “She can’t, I’ll explain to you later. Stella, I didn’t let you play because I wanted you to talk more and go outside.”
I would play games all day if given a choice so I have no way to argue. I still want to play though...
(Silva) “Is that what she asked you? All I heard her ask was ‘Why?’.”
(Nox) “Yeah, that is why I want her to talk more. If she talks more she can get used to it faster.”
(Silva) “I see. Then why don’t we all play and ‘talk’ about how to deal with that corrupt pope.”
(Nox) “I… Ok, you win. We can play games while discussing strategies, but Stella, you need to go on a walk at least once a day. We can see nearby scenic spots or just explore nearby, but you need some fresh air. Got it?”
(Stella) (Ok.) yay, video games!
